Transaction 180d77c5126f3093d95a505448d421a25f84d51492f412a540b618fe507a5730

1 Input
2 Outputs
  • 180d77c5126f3093d95a505448d421a25f84d51492f412a540b618fe507a5730:0
  • value  985251
    address  1LLrDS7E6RAT7FbhnaGyg2gBmuh9KfkkDv
  • 180d77c5126f3093d95a505448d421a25f84d51492f412a540b618fe507a5730:1
  • value  2464044
    address  19ihXAq3VRd892ZhLHf3h8RQhEPEhxFwSP